Mortgage Rates Expected to Move Lower

This week is expected push mortgage rates lower for the third straight week. Although the week is light on formal economic announcements it is expected to be heavy on Federal policy announcements. If recent history holds firm this will send equity markets into turmoil. The combination of bank nationalization discussion and President Obama's first state of the union is certain to send the bond market on the rise, triggering declines in mortgage rates.
